Google Discover Feed
The Google Discover Follow Feed feature provides relevant content to Chrome Android users and is a valuable source of traffic that matches users’ interests.
Google Discover Follow is a component of Google Discover, a way to capture a continuous stream of traffic apart from Google News and Google Search.
Google’s Discover Follow feature works by allowing users to choose to receive updates about the latest content on a site they are interested in.
The way to participate in Discover Follow is through an enhanced RSS or Atom feed.
If the feed is properly optimized on a website, users can choose to follow a specific website or category of website, depending on how the publisher configures their RSS/Atom feeds.
Audiences who follow a website will see the new content populate their Discover Follow feed which in turn brings new waves of traffic to participating websites that are properly optimized.
The Follow feature allows people to follow a website and get the latest updates from that website in the Follow tab of Discover in Chrome.
Currently, the Continue button is a feature available to users who are signed in in English in the United States, New Zealand, South Africa, the United Kingdom, Canada, and Australia using Chrome Android.
Receiving Discover Follow traffic only happens to sites with properly optimized feeds that follow the Discover Follow Guidelines.
